WebMar 18, 2024 · Use the –s option to run PsPing in server mode. The complete server-mode, command-line syntax is psping [-6 -4] [-f] -s address:port To end PsPing server mode, press Ctrl+C. Before it exits, PsPing deletes any firewall rules that it created. WebJan 9, 2024 · Port 7 (both TCP and UDP) is used for the "echo" service. If this service is available on a computer, UDP port 7 could be used instead of ICMP to perform a "ping". However, most modern computers don't have the "echo" service running, so performing "ping" using UDP port 7 instead of ICMP would not work.
